Here are five of my favorite easy ways to add spruce up an outdoor space without breaking the budget.

Outdoor pillows can add color and softness to the otherwise hard lines of an outdoor space, making if feel a lot more plush and homey. Try mixing texture and patterns the same way you would indoors and layer them over a neutral sofa for an easy way to change out the look should the mood strike.

Some of my favorite places for outdoor pillows are Pottery Barn and Ballard Designs, World Market also has a ton of choices at a good price point. Or you could sew your own. Last year I recovered my old cushions with some outdoor fabric and reused the stuffing. It was such a great way to get the look without the price.

Potted plants and window boxes are one of the highest impact things you can do to freshen up your outdoor space. We even built some of our own deck boxes last summer. Use a large pot and tropical plants in the summer months to add height and privacy or smaller pots and a few annuals to add additional color and texture. But remember to get the right kind of plants for your space. I’ve learned from experience that shade loving plants won’t do well in a space that gets full sun no matter how much you water them.
Outdoor lighting can have such an impact on how you transition from day to night while sitting outside. The right kind of lighting casts an ethereal glow over everything and calls you to stay a little longer. We’re dying to add some layers of lighting. Maybe a few string lights and tiki torches and to help set the mood. I love Target for great lighting options at a good price.

Outdoor rugs define an outdoor space and make it feel grounded. Rugs can section off an area for sitting, add color or create a cushy place for bare feet to land. The great thing about outdoor rugs are that there are as many options and and price points as their are personal styles and budgets.

Paint, Think painting is just for the indoors? What if your patios space is ugly, stained and totally lacks personality. Do what Brittany of Brittany Makes did and paint a bold stencil pattern onto the floor. With some elbow grease, a stencil and paint you too could transform your space into an entertainers paradise.
